T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of wood sanding, in particular to a desktop thick and flat sanding mechanism and solid wood processing equipment. BACKGROUND
[0002] The sanding process improves the smoothness, flatness and dimensional accuracy of the wood surface by reducing or eliminating defects on the wood surface, and is an important link to improve the surface quality of solid wood.
[0003] At present, the belt sanding mechanism mainly includes a contact roller sanding mechanism and a sanding pad sanding mechanism. The former tightens the sanding belt on the upper and lower rollers, and one of the rollers presses the workpiece for grinding. This kind of sanding mechanism relies on the roller to press the workpiece, the contact area is small, the unit pressure is large, and it is mainly used for rough grinding or fixed thickness sanding. The latter tightens the sanding belt to the workpiece through the sanding pad for grinding. The unit pressure of this kind of sanding mechanism is small, the contact area with the workpiece is large, and it is mainly used for fine grinding or semi-fine grinding.
[0004] In order to improve the sanding efficiency and simultaneously carry out fine grinding and rough grinding of wood, the contact roller sanding mechanism and the sanding pad sanding mechanism are usually combined and arranged on the workpiece feeding route in the solid wood processing equipment. However, this configuration will increase the volume of the solid wood processing equipment, and has high requirements for transportation and operation space. When the production process changes, the position of the equipment cannot be adjusted in time. SUMMARY
[0005] Therefore, the present application aims to provide a desktop thick and flat sanding mechanism and solid wood processing equipment, which realizes the functions of fine grinding and rough grinding through the deformation of one sanding mechanism, and solves the problem of large volume occupied by the belt sanding mechanism in the prior art.

[0033] In the first aspect, refer to Figures 1 to 8 A desktop thick flat sanding mechanism provided by the present application comprises a driving roller 100, a first driven roller 200, an adhesive tape 300, a second driven roller 400, a sanding belt 500 and a position conversion structure 600.
[0034] Specifically, the driving roller 100 is used to connect an external driving device, which can be installed on a workbench so that the driving roller 100 rotates. The first driven roller 200 is arranged in parallel with the driving roller 100 at intervals, and the second driven roller 400 is also arranged in parallel with the driving roller 100 at intervals. The adhesive tape 300 is wound around the driving roller 100 and the first driven roller 200, and the sanding belt 500 is wound around the driving roller 100 and the second driven roller 400, and the sanding belt 500 surrounds the first driven roller 200.
[0035] In the first structural form, the driving roller 100, the first driven roller 200 and the second driven roller 400 are parallel in the vertical direction, and the rotational center lines of the three are in the same vertical plane. The adhesive tape 300 is tensioned by the first driven roller 200 and the driving roller 100, and the sanding belt 500 is tensioned by the second driven roller 400 and the driving roller 100. At the same time, the sanding belt 500 and the adhesive tape 300 run at the same speed and in the same direction under the driving force provided by the driving roller 100, so that there is no relative sliding between the sanding belt 500 and the adhesive tape 300. When sanding the surface of wood, the driving roller 100 presses the wood for grinding.
[0036] The position conversion structure 600 is used to adjust the relative position of the first driven roller 200 and the driving roller 100. Specifically, the position conversion structure 600 comprises a quarter circular arc rack 610, a sliding seat 620, a gear 630, a first driver 640, the left end of the quarter circular arc rack 610 is parallel to the position of the driving roller 100, and the quarter circular arc rack 610 is arranged in position alignment with the driving roller 100 in the vertical direction, the right end of the quarter circular arc rack 610 is parallel to the position of the driving roller 100, and the quarter circular arc rack 610 is arranged in position alignment with the driving roller 100 in the horizontal direction. The sliding seat 620 is slidingly arranged on the quarter circular arc rack 610 and is limited on the quarter circular arc rack 610 to prevent the sliding seat 620 from falling off the quarter circular arc rack 610, a row of gear teeth 611 is arranged on the circumferential extension path of the quarter circular arc rack 610, the gear 630 is rotatably arranged on the sliding seat 620, and the gear 630 is meshingly connected with the gear teeth 611 on the quarter circular arc rack 610, the first driven roller 200 is rotatably arranged on the sliding seat 620, and the first driver 640 is drivingly connected with the gear 630. When the first driver 640 is in a working state, the first driver 640 drives the gear 630 to rotate, the rotation of the gear 630 drives the sliding seat 620 to move as a whole on the gear teeth 611, so that the sliding seat 620 can move from the left end of the quarter circular arc rack 610 to the right end of the quarter circular arc rack 610, or can move from the right end of the quarter circular arc rack 610 to the left end of the quarter circular arc rack 610. Optionally, the first driver 640 can be a rotary motor, a rotary cylinder, a rotary hydraulic cylinder or the like power device.
[0037] After the position conversion structure 600 is adjusted to the second structural form, the positions of the driving roller 100 and the second driven roller 400 do not change, and the driving roller 100, the first driven roller 200 and the second driven roller 400 are still in a parallel state, but at this time the rotation center line of the first driven roller 200 and the driving roller 100 is in the same horizontal plane, the adhesive tape 300 is tensioned by the first driven roller 200 and the driving roller 100, the abrasive belt 500 is tensioned by the driving roller 100, the first driven roller 200 and the second driven roller 400, and at the same time the abrasive belt 500 and the adhesive tape 300 run at the same speed and in the same direction under the driving force provided by the driving roller 100, so that there is no relative sliding between the abrasive belt 500 and the adhesive tape 300. When sanding the surface of the wood, the abrasive belt 500 tensioned between the driving roller 100 and the first driven roller 200 presses the wood for grinding.
[0038] In the embodiment, the structure of the sand frame composed of the driving roller 100, the first driven roller 200, the adhesive tape 300, the second driven roller 400 and the abrasive belt 500 is deformed by the position conversion structure 600, so that the two types of sand frame structures can be switched freely, and the fine grinding and coarse grinding functions can be switched freely. Thus, the two types of sand frame structures do not need to be installed on the solid wood processing equipment at the same time, and the occupied volume of the equipment is reduced.
[0039] In some optional embodiments, in order to limit the sliding seat 620 on the circular arc rack at all times and prevent the sliding seat 620 from falling off the quarter circular arc rack 610, a quarter circular arc guide rail 650 is arranged on the end surface of the quarter circular arc rack 610. Figure 5 As shown in the figure, the position conversion structure 600 further comprises a quarter circular arc guide rail 650. Specifically, the quarter circular arc guide rail 650 is arranged on the end surface of the quarter circular arc rack 610, and the upper and lower ends of the quarter circular arc guide rail 650 are provided with sliding surfaces 651, the two sliding surfaces 651 are parallel to each other, and the extension paths of the two sliding surfaces 651 are also parallel to the extension path of the gear teeth 611. The sliding seat 620 is provided with upper and lower symmetrically or asymmetrically arranged rollers 621, which are clamped between the quarter circular arc guide rail 650 when assembled, and abut on the two sliding surfaces 651 respectively. When the sliding seat 620 moves on the quarter circular arc rack 610, the rollers 621 roll along the sliding surfaces 651. It can be understood that the middle part of the roller 621 can be concave relative to the two ends, and the sliding surface 651 is correspondingly arranged as a convex sliding surface, so that the roller 621 will not move off the sliding surface 651 when moving on the sliding surface 651. Of course, the middle part of the roller 621 can also be convex relative to the two ends, and the sliding surface 651 is correspondingly arranged as a concave sliding surface.
[0040] During the rotation of the first driven roller 200, the circumference around the driving roller 100, the first driven roller 200 and the second driven roller 400 changes. In order to change the two types of sand frame structures without disassembling the abrasive belt 500, the length of the abrasive belt 500 needs to be changed correspondingly. Therefore, in some optional embodiments, as shown in the figure, Figure 3As shown, the second driven roller 400 comprises a roller frame 410, three roller shafts 420 rotatably arranged on the roller frame 410, and a floating locking mechanism 430. Specifically, the centers of the three roller shafts 420 are in a triangular distribution, the middle roller shaft 420 is located below the remaining two roller shafts 420, and the adhesive tape 300 is sequentially wound around the peripheral surfaces of the three roller shafts 420. It should be noted that the triangular distribution can be an equilateral triangle, an isosceles triangle, or other triangles, but the abrasive belt 500 should be able to smoothly pass through the three roller shafts 420. The floating locking mechanism 430 is in driving connection with the middle roller shaft 420. During the movement of the first driven roller 200, the floating locking mechanism 430 drives the middle roller shaft 420 to move up and down on the roller frame 410. When the middle roller shaft 420 moves up and down, the length of the abrasive belt 500 wrapped therearound changes, thereby avoiding the abrasive belt 500 from blocking the rotation of the first driven roller 200. In addition, when the first driven roller 200 moves from the vertical position to the position horizontally flush with the driving roller 100, the floating locking mechanism 430 can lock the middle roller shaft 420. At this time, the tension of the abrasive belt 500 no longer changes, unless the relative positions among the driving roller 100, the first driven roller 200, and the second driven roller 400 are further changed.
[0041] In some optional embodiments, the right end of the quarter-circular arc rack 610 is provided with a contact sensor (not shown in the drawings). Optionally, the contact sensor can be a pressure sensor, a capacitive sensor, a photoelectric sensor, or the like. As shown in the figure, Figure 2 、 Figure 6 As shown, the floating locking mechanism 430 comprises a housing 431, a piston 432, a sliding rod 433, and a balance assembly 434. The housing 431 is fixedly connected with the roller frame 410. The housing 431 is internally provided with a sealed cavity 4311, a filling port 4312, and a sliding port 4313. The filling port 4312 and the sliding port 4313 are in communication with the sealed cavity 4311. In use, the filling port 4312 is used to connect a pressure medium conveying device. The pressure medium conveying device injects or extracts pressure medium into or out of the sealed cavity 4311 through the filling port 4312. The sliding port 4313 is located at the bottom of the sealed cavity 4311. The piston 432 is slidably arranged in the sealed cavity 4311 and can slide up and down in the sealed cavity 4311. Optionally, a sealing ring (not shown in the drawings) can be arranged between the piston 432 and the cavity wall of the sealed cavity 4311 to prevent the pressure medium from leaking from the edge of the piston 432. The sliding rod 433 is correspondingly arranged in the shape of the sliding port 4313. One end of the sliding rod 433 is connected with the piston 432, and the other end of the sliding rod 433 extends from the sliding port 4313 to the outside of the sealed cavity 4311. The part of the sliding rod 433 located outside the sealed cavity 4311 is connected with the middle roller shaft 420.
[0042] In the embodiment, when the pressure medium is not filled into the sealed cavity 4311 from the filling port 4312, the piston 432 is in a state of balance of upward and downward forces, so in the process that the first driven roller 200 moves from the vertical position to the position horizontally level with the driving roller 100, when the circumferences around the driving roller 100, the first driven roller 200 and the second driven roller 400 become larger, the intermediate roller shaft 420 is driven by the sand belt 500 to move upward on the roller frame 410, and then the sliding rod 433 is driven to move upward in the sliding port 4313, the upward movement of the sliding rod 433 drives the piston 432 to move upward in the sealed cavity 4311, and the sand belt 500 will not be too tight or loose under the action of the balancing assembly 434; similarly, when the circumferences around the driving roller 100, the first driven roller 200 and the second driven roller 400 become smaller, the piston 432 is driven to move downward in the sealed cavity 4311 under the action of the balancing assembly 434, and then the sliding rod 433 is driven to move downward in the sliding port 4313, the downward movement of the sliding rod 433 drives the intermediate roller shaft 420 to move downward on the roller frame 410, until the sand belt 500 will not be too tight or loose under the action of the balancing assembly 434. In addition, when the sliding seat 620 abuts against the contact sensor, the pressure medium conveying device fills the pressure medium into the sealed cavity 4311, so that the piston 432 remains in a fixed state, that is, the piston 432 cannot move upward and downward in the sealed cavity 4311; when the sliding seat 620 is away from the sensor, the pressure medium conveying device extracts the pressure medium filled in the sealed cavity 4311.
[0043] In some optional embodiments, as shown in Figure 6 The sliding port 4313 is a stepped port, the large end of the sliding port 4313 is at the top, and the small end of the sliding port 4313 is at the bottom, and correspondingly, the sliding rod 433 is also arranged in a stepped shape, the thin rod body of the sliding rod 433 is arranged in the small end of the sliding port 4313, and the thick rod body of the sliding rod 433 is arranged in the large end of the sliding port 4313. The balancing assembly 434 includes oppositely arranged first springs 4341 and second springs 4342, wherein the number of the first springs 4341 can be set to be multiple, the upper and lower ends of the first springs 4341 are connected with the top wall of the sealed cavity 4311 and the upper surface of the piston 432 respectively, and the number of the second springs 4342 can also be set to be multiple, the upper and lower ends of the second springs 4342 are connected with the large end of the sliding port 4313 and the lower surface of the piston 432 respectively. When the driving roller 100, the first driven roller 200 and the second driven roller 400 are in the position parallel in the vertical direction, the piston 432 is in a balanced position, at this time, the sum of the downward elastic force of the first springs 4341 and the gravity of the piston 432 and the sliding rod 433 is equal to the upward elastic force of the second springs 4342.
[0044] In some optional embodiments, in order to make the intermediate roller shaft 420 move more stably upward and downward, as shown in Figure 2As shown in the drawings, the roller frame 410 is provided with a sliding block 411, and the middle roller shaft 420 is rotatably arranged on the sliding block 411, and the sliding block 411 is connected with the sliding rod 433. In this way, the up-down movement of the sliding rod 433 drives the sliding block 411 to move up and down on the roller frame 410, and in turn drives the middle roller shaft 420 to move up and down.
[0045] In order to press the adhesive tape 300 against the sand belt 500, so that the adhesive tape 300 and the sand belt 500 do not slide relative to each other, and at the same time the sand belt 500 can grind the uneven wood board, when the first driven roller 200 moves from the vertical position to the position horizontally flush with the driving roller 100, in some optional embodiments, as shown in the drawings, Figure 1 、 Figure 4 As shown in the drawings, a plurality of pressure pad assemblies 700 are arranged between the driving roller 100 and the first driven roller 200. Specifically, the pressure pad assembly 700 includes a floating roller 710, a connecting frame 720, and a reset mechanism 730. The floating roller 710 is pressed against the inner surface of the end of the adhesive tape 300 away from the second driven roller 400, and the end of the floating roller 710 is rotatably arranged on the connecting frame 720. The connecting frame 720 is rotatably arranged on the sliding seat 620, and the reset mechanism 730 is arranged between the connecting frame 720 and the sliding seat 620. When the floating roller 710 moves away from its equilibrium position, the reset mechanism 730 provides a reverse restoring force, so that when the uneven wood board is sanded, the floating roller 710 moves up and down near its equilibrium position, and at the same time the floating roller 710 rotates relative to the connecting frame 720, which can make the adhesive tape 300 smoothly slide on the floating roller 710. It should be noted that the equilibrium position of the floating roller 710 can be set according to actual conditions. For example, when a larger grinding amount is required, the equilibrium position of the floating roller 710 can be adjusted to increase the downward pressure on the adhesive tape 300 and the sand belt 500.
[0046] In some optional embodiments, as shown in the drawings, Figure 8 The reset mechanism 730 includes two positioning columns 731 and a torsional spring 732. Specifically, the two positioning columns 731 are fixedly installed on the sliding seat 620, and the two positioning columns 731 are respectively located on both sides of the rotation center of the connecting frame 720. The torsional spring 732 is sleeved on the rotation shaft of the connecting frame 720 and the sliding seat 620, and the two ends of the torsional spring 732 are respectively abutted against the two positioning columns 731. In this embodiment, when the floating roller 710 moves up and down near its equilibrium position, the floating roller 710 drives the connecting frame 720 to rotate relative to the sliding seat 620. At this time, the ends of the torsional spring 732 are blocked by the positioning columns 731 and cannot rotate, so that the torsional spring 732 generates an elastic force to resist the continuous rotation of the connecting frame 720. In this way, through the floating of the floating roller 710, the uneven wood board is effectively adapted, so that the convex part is subjected to increased downward pressure, ensuring that the convex part has a larger grinding amount when sanded, and in turn ensuring the precision of fine grinding.
[0047] During the rotation of the sanding belt 500, it may deviate from its designated path on the driving roller 100, the first driven roller 200, and the second driven roller 400. Therefore, in some alternative embodiments, such as... Figure 4 , Figure 7 As shown, the desktop thick sanding mechanism also includes a reciprocating swing mechanism 800. The reciprocating swing mechanism 800 swings the second driven roller 400 left and right on the horizontal plane. The second driven roller 400 swings left and right and generates a lateral force on the sanding belt 500. This force can counteract the tendency of the sanding belt 500 to deviate due to various reasons, so that the sanding belt 500 is not easy to deviate. Specifically, the reciprocating swing mechanism 800 includes a swing frame 810, two swing rods 820, an arc-shaped swing arm 830, an inclined block 840, and a second driver 850. The swing frame 810 is rotatably mounted around a vertical central axis. It should be noted that the vertical central axis refers to the central axis perpendicular to the plane in which the second driven roller 400 swings horizontally. The same-side ends of the two swing rods 820 are rotatably mounted at both ends of the swing frame 810, and the other ends of the two swing rods 820 are rotatably mounted at both ends of the second driven roller 400. Both ends of the arc-shaped swing arm 830 are rotatably connected to the swing frame 810, and the rotation center line of the arc-shaped swing arm 830 is parallel to the rotation center line of the second driven roller 400. The inclined block 840 is rotatably connected to the arc-shaped swing arm 830, and the second driver 850 is drively connected to the inclined block 840. When the second driver 850 is in operation, it drives the tilting block 840 to rotate. As the tilting block 840 rotates, its rotation center line forms an acute angle with the rotation center line of the second driver 850. At this time, the tilting block 840 drives the arc-shaped swing arm 830 to rotate back and forth on the swing frame 810, and simultaneously drives the arc-shaped swing arm 830 to swing left and right. The left and right swing of the arc-shaped swing arm 830 causes the swing frame 810 to rotate clockwise and counterclockwise, which in turn causes the second driven roller 400 to swing left and right via the two swing rods 820. Optionally, the second driver 850 can be a rotary motor, rotary cylinder, rotary hydraulic cylinder, or other power device.
[0048] It should be noted that in order to keep the position of the second driven roller 400 relatively fixed, the roller frame 410 can be movably mounted on the worktable. In this way, when the reciprocating swing mechanism 800 is working, the two ends of the roller frame 410 can swing in the horizontal direction, thereby driving the two ends of the second driven roller 400 to swing in the horizontal direction.

[0050] In summary, by deforming the structure of the sand frame composed of the driving roller 100, the first driven roller 200, the adhesive tape 300, the second driven roller 400 and the abrasive belt 500 through the position conversion structure 600, the free switching of the two types of sand frame structures can be realized, and then the free switching of the fine grinding and coarse grinding functions can be realized, so that the sand frame of the two types of structures does not need to be installed on the solid wood processing equipment at the same time, and the occupied volume of the equipment is reduced; at the same time, since the adhesive tape 300 is always in a tension state during the rotation of the first driven roller 200, the position of the adhesive tape 300 does not need to be adjusted after the structure is deformed, so that the transformation efficiency is improved.
